🏴 Featured Whisky
Whisky of the Month: Talisker 10 Year
Isle of Skye · Single Malt · 45.8% ABV
Talisker is often described as maritime, but that word doesn’t quite do it justice. This is a whisky that smells like weather—salt air, peat smoke, and something elemental.
Tasting Notes
- Nose: Sea spray, campfire smoke, citrus peel
- Palate: Peppery heat, malt sweetness, brine
- Finish: Long, warming, gently smoky
Talisker sits beautifully at the crossroads of peat and balance. It reminds us that intensity, when disciplined, can still be elegant.
🌎 Beyond Scotland
Bourbon Sidebar: Elijah Craig Small Batch
For those evenings when peat feels a bit too stern, Elijah Craig offers a softer conversation—caramel, vanilla, and oak without shouting for attention. A fine reminder that bourbon rewards patience just as much as Scotch does.
(If you try it side-by-side with Talisker, notice how sweetness and smoke answer one another.)
